What are the challenges in creating a talking dog in augmented science fiction?

2 answers
2024-12-06 18:28

Another issue is the technology aspect in augmented science fiction. How does the dog gain the ability to talk? Is it through some kind of genetic modification, a technological implant, or something else? Writers need to come up with a plausible explanation. For instance, if it's a genetic mod, they have to consider the ethical implications as well as the scientific feasibility.

What are the common themes in dog detective fiction?

1 answer
2024-11-27 21:22

One common theme is the special bond between the dog and its human partner. In most of these stories, the dog and the human work together to solve crimes. Another theme is the dog's unique abilities, like a great sense of smell or hearing, which help in detecting clues. Also, loyalty is often a theme, as the dog is always loyal to its owner and the cause of solving the mystery.

What are the common themes in fiction dog stories?

2 answers
2024-11-18 11:35

Loyalty is a very common theme. In most fiction dog stories, the dog is extremely loyal to its owner or the people it cares about, like in 'Lassie Come - Home'. Another theme is friendship. For example, in 'Because of Winn - Dixie', the bond between the girl and the dog is a strong friendship. Adventure is also common. In 'The Call of the Wild', Buck has many adventures in the Yukon.
